Features  
TE Connectivity is pleased to introduce its LPT Series of Low-Profile Tactile  
Switches. Given the various combinations of Size and Height measures offered by  
the LPT Series, these tactile switches are ideal for a wide variety of applications  
within the portable electronics market.  
Compact size.  
Low-profile.  
Long operation  
life.  
The Low-Profile Tactile Switches will be characterised by SMT mounting available  
in Tab, Gull-Winged, and J-Bend terminations.

5. Soldering Conditions:  
Condition for Soldering MCSLPT Series:  
The condition noted above is the temperature of the copper foil on the surface of the PCB. There  
are cases where the temperature of the board greatly differs from the surface of the switch. Do not  
allow the surface temperature of the switch to exceed 260.  
Manual Soldering  
Soldering Temperature: 350Max.  
Continuous Soldering Time: 5 second Max.

Precautions in Handling  
1. Care should be exercised so that flux from the top surface of the printed circuit board does not  
adhere to the switch.  
2. Do not wash the switch.  
Operating precautions  
1. Do not actuate the switch with excessive force.  
2. Discontinue force after the switch has been actuated so as to avoid deformation of the components  
of the switch. Deformation of the components may cause the switch to malfunction.  
3. Align the plunger with the switch to insure proper operation.  
Notes on storage conditions  
Avoid the following as exposure may affect the performance and/or the soldering of the switch:  
1. Temperature of -10 to +40& 85% humidity.  
2. Exposure to corrosive gas.  
3. Storage over 6 months  
4. Exposure to direct sunlight.  
5. Storage conditions should prevent heavy impact or loading.  
6. After opening the package, unused switches must be repackaged in a moisture-proof and airtight  
environment.
